Output 30bba819a26c053e4363ca8716b7c370a6a14cd31228e59781a2757666093985:6

value
151533202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1cebb21737b1656dcf08e7c91e210a806d28157 OP_EQUAL
address
3GSaNMBHMu5DBqgk2cLrxg7p4gDZJaNsPi
transaction
30bba819a26c053e4363ca8716b7c370a6a14cd31228e59781a2757666093985
spent
true